Meeting Description:

Languages in the public space of the Francophone world
Linguistic Landscape Studies at the interface of contact linguistics, sociology of language and linguistic ecology

Session Organizers:

Mónica Castillo Lluch (University of Lausanne / Switzerland)
Alexandra Duppé (RWTH Aachen / Germany)
Claus D. Pusch (University of Freiburg im Breisgau / Germany)

This session is organized in the context of the 9th German Congress on French Language and Literature (9. Kongress des Frankoromanistenverbandes) at Westfälische Wilhelms University in Münster, Germany. Practical information on travel, accommodation, the inscription procedure etc. will be available on the conference website at http://www.uni-muenster.de/Romanistik/Aktuelles/Frankoromanistenkongress/kongress.html.

Final Call for Papers:

In recent decades, Linguistic Landscape Studies (LLS) has established itself as an analytic approach towards the presence of (written) language(s) in the public space.

We invite case studies of LLS in the Francophone world and papers on methodological questions related to LLS. Please check http://www.romanistik.uni-freiburg.de/pusch/LLS_Muenster_2014/ for a detailed presentation of the panel's aims and the full CfP (available in French and English).
